noun
- plural of deodorization; the processes or instances of removing or neutralizing unpleasant odors
Usage: typically used in technical, commercial, or scientific contexts
Examples
- The factory implemented several deodorizations to improve air quality in the facility.
- Modern deodorizations of wastewater treatment plants use activated carbon and chemical processes.
- The deodorizations of the refrigerator involved baking soda and proper ventilation.
- Industrial deodorizations require specialized equipment and trained technicians.
- Regular deodorizations help maintain hygiene standards in commercial kitchens.
